Federal judge blocks Trump bid to revoke Harvard’s international student enrolment

AI Summary

A federal judge extended an order preventing the Trump administration from revoking Harvard's ability to enroll international students. This is a win for Harvard, which is facing multiple challenges from the administration, including frozen funding, potential loss of tax-exempt status, and a discrimination investigation. International students comprise over 25% of Harvard's student body, with nearly 60% at the Kennedy School. This action is part of a broader administration effort to influence higher education, including revoking visas for some Chinese students.
